Describe the best meal you’ve ever eaten.

The best meal I have ever eaten was at St John restaurant in London. It is my favourite joint of all time, and the laser focus and single narrative of the place is something I strive to achieve at Africola. I could eat there for every single meal, every single day. Think Welsh rarebit, braised oxtail and mash, bone marrow and parsley salad and a magnum of claret. Perfection.
